Transaction 8109b2a6eff6b8aecb9f03cc9ca4c124ef95902b9580eb512cc5ab73f48f1141

6 Input
1 Outputs
  • 8109b2a6eff6b8aecb9f03cc9ca4c124ef95902b9580eb512cc5ab73f48f1141:0
  • value  264680
    address  3D5BJjvmbY6AGDLhVVAZqvwAKkuFCR3FSA